A peace walk by supporters of the New Patriotic Party (NPP) and National Democratic Congress (NDC) turned violent in Jamestown in the Odododiodio constituency this morning, Sunday October 25, 2020.

According to sources, the fight was intense on the ‘Atta Mills Highway’ at a popular junction known as ‘One Way’.

In the disturbing videos circulating online, supporters of both parties were seen throwing stones at their opponents.

It is not clear what spark the supporters of incumbent NDC MP, Nii Lante Vanderpuye and NPP’s Nii Lante Bannerman to start violent exchanges.

According to reports, the police have intervened and they have said that both parties have written their statements about what started the violence. So far, the number of injured or possible fatalities is yet to be confirmed.
